Catalog description

Addresses issues that connect academic and clinical practice. Topics involve preparation for second-year field experiences and target understanding of a variety of related professional topics. Students apply critical thinking, ethics, and counseling knowledge and skills to case studies. Students are introduced to Clinical Fellow guidelines and job preparation. <i>May be repeated once for degree credit. Pass/Fail</i>
